is a Professor and the Head of the Department. With a Ph.D. in High Voltage Engineering, she has over 22 years of experience in teaching and research. Her expertise is widely recognized; she has been appointed as a 'Margadarshak' by the AICTE to mentor other institutions, holds two patents, and has received numerous awards, including the Bharat Jyoti Award and the Distinguished Researcher Award. She has successfully guided 13 Ph.D. scholars and published over 90 research papers in prestigious journals.

"Electrical Machine Design" by V. Rajini and V.A.S.P.S. Sastry is a vital resource for anyone serious about mastering the design of electrical equipment. Its combination of clear theory, practical examples, and industry-relevant methodologies makes it a standout text.
